On Thu, 2007-05-24 at 13:22 -0700, Jared Hulbert wrote:
> On 5/22/07, Richard Griffiths <res07ml0@verizon.net> wrote:
> > Venerable cramfs fs Linear XIP patch originally from MontaVista, used in
> > the embedded Linux community for years, updated for 2.6.21. Tested on
> > several systems with NOR Flash. PXA270, TI OMAP2430, ARM Versatile and
> > Freescale iMX31ADS.
> >
>
> When trying to verify this patch on our PXA270 system we get the
> following error when running an XIP rootfs:
>
> cramfs: checking physical address 0xa00000 for linear cramfs image
> cramfs: linear cramfs image appears to be 3236 KB in size
> VFS: Mounted root (cramfs filesystem) readonly.
> Freeing init memory: 96K
> /sbin/init: error while loading shared libraries: libgcc_s.so.1:
> failed to map segment from shared object: Error 11
> Kernel panic - not syncing: Attempted to kill init!
>
> However, if our busybox binary is XIP while the libgcc_s.so.1 is not
> XIP, busybox runs fine.
> Richard, May I email you the rootfs tarball so you can recreate what
> we are seeing? It is a little less than 2MiB. The filing system
> executables will only run on a PXA27x processor.
Yes you can, but I won't have access to a PXA270 for a few weeks. I
assume you don't see the issue if you static link busybox? BTW I'm using
uclibc rather than glibc - much smaller fs.
Richard
